“Commitment”

We are committed to our vision, mission, and to creating and delivering stakeholder value.

Commitment means being dedicated and engaged towards assigned obligations. It is the psychological attachment of
an employee with his organization as well as a key factor to build employees motivation and confidence to engage
them to exert efforts on the behalf of organization. A meaningful commitment gives employees a possible script for
how to handle the situation when times get tough by looking towards innovative solutions and make them persistent
and extremely resilient. So, this value acts as a catalyst for cultivating a stable and efficient workforce. Thus,
committed employees prove to be an asset to the Company as they are determined to work hard, show relatively
high productivity, are more constructive, and pledged to follow the vision and mission of the organization.

Being engaged and motivated to achieve organizational objectives is expected to be a standard norm here at
SNGPL. However, it has been observed that practical implementation of this value is not seen in employees work
performance. Therefore, in order to improve the organizational culture and to gain competitive advantage,
employees must show commitment to their work. Employees commitment is affected by several factors i.e. bad boss
experience, lack of personal and career growth opportunities, low empowerment, not feel valued, disruption in
work-life balance, lack of open communication and feel ambiguity about organization’s goals and directions. Hence,
lack of this value has lead to turnover, absenteeism, has escalated negligence to do assigned duties, reduced
productivity and well being of employees. Keeping in view the above mentioned facts, SNGPL strongly recognizes
the fact that commitment, trust and empowerment go hand-in-hand. To make commitment value bountiful for both
the Company and the employees, Organization is implementing Affective Commitment practices in which
employees develop a connection with company, feel that they fit in and understand that their personal values and
goals aligned with organizational goals and values rather than showing commitment just for the monetary purposes.
In order to ensure the practical implementation of Affective Commitment practices, the Company has extrinsically
motivated our employees by providing them benefits like job security, incentives, promotions etc. Moreover, the
Company has been taking initiatives to keep our employees satisfied by clarifying their roles and duties, providing
flexible work schedules, encouraging creativity and novel ideas, giving appraisals, creating accountability and
ensuring organizational fairness which demonstrates the organization’s commitment towards the employees well
being.
